#041ce2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#041ce2 is composed of 1.6% red, 11% green and 88.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 98.2% cyan, 87.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 11.4% black. It has a hue angle of 233.5 degrees, a saturation of 96.5% and a lightness of 45.1%. #041ce2 color hex could be obtained by blending #0838ff with #0000c5. Closest websafe color is: #0033cc.

#041ce2 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#041ce2 has RGB values of R:4, G:28, B:226 and CMYK values of C:0.98, M:0.88, Y:0, K:0.11. Its decimal value is 269538.
